10 Grey Couch Living Room Ideas for Minimal, Modern, and Comfy Style

A grey couch is the ultimate blank canvas for any living room. It’s versatile, chic, and works with minimal, modern, and cozy styles alike. Whether you’re decorating your first apartment or refreshing your home, these 10 ideas will inspire your next living room makeover.

1. Soft Neutrals for Minimal Vibes

Pair your grey couch with white walls, light wood accents, and neutral rugs. Keep accessories simple—think a single textured throw and a couple of minimalist art pieces. The result is a serene, clutter-free space that feels spacious and airy.

2. Modern Monochrome

Go sleek with a monochrome palette: charcoal grey, black, and white. Add a geometric rug, black metal accents, and a statement floor lamp. This approach creates a modern, urban feel that’s bold but balanced.

3. Warm & Cozy

Turn your living room into a comfy retreat by layering warm textures over your grey couch. Soft throws, velvet cushions, and a shaggy rug instantly make the space inviting. Add a warm-toned coffee table or wooden accents for extra coziness.

4. Pop of Color

Grey is the perfect neutral backdrop for color pops. Bright cushions, vibrant artwork, or a bold area rug can transform your living room without overwhelming the space. This style is perfect for anyone who loves a touch of personality with a modern twist.

5. Scandinavian Simplicity

Think light wood furniture, clean lines, and greenery. A grey couch fits perfectly into this Scandinavian-inspired aesthetic. Add a soft beige rug, a simple coffee table, and a few indoor plants for a fresh, minimal look.

6. Industrial Edge

Pair your grey couch with exposed brick walls, black metal shelving, and concrete accents. This combination gives your living room a modern-industrial edge while keeping it stylish and cozy.

7. Layered Textures

Mix and match materials: chunky knit throws, leather cushions, and soft rugs on your grey couch. Layering textures adds depth and interest, making even a minimal color palette feel rich and inviting.

8. Open & Airy

Keep your grey couch as the focal point in an open-plan living room. Surround it with light-colored walls, glass or acrylic furniture, and subtle décor accents. This style maximizes natural light and creates a peaceful, airy environment.

9. Minimal with Metallic Accents

Add a touch of glamour to a minimalist grey couch setup with gold or brass accents. Think a sleek floor lamp, a side table, or decorative trays. Metallic elements elevate the look without cluttering the space.

10. Comfy Family-Friendly Style

For homes with kids or pets, a grey couch is both stylish and practical. Add washable throws, soft cushions, and durable rugs. Layer in cozy lighting and fun art pieces to make the room welcoming for the whole family.
